These circular orifices are located at the upper ends of the outflow parts of the left and right ventricles respectively. The pulmonary orifice which is 3 cms, is 0.5 cm larger than the aortic orifice. The aortic orifice is placed in front and to the right of the mitral orifice. The pulmonary orifice is placed above and to the left of the tricuspid orifice and the aortic orifice intervening between them. The pulmonary orifice is guarded by the pulmonary valve and the aortic orifice by the aortic valve. Each valve consists of three semilunar cusps. Each cusp is triangular. It has a convex edge which is attached to the part of the margin of the orifice. It has two free margins that meet at the apex of the cusp. Each cusp consists of a double fold of endocardium with some fibrous tissue in it. The region of the apex is thickened to form a nodule while crescentric parts near the free edges are called lunules.
